Hi there--

We're in the layout phase of designing a bathroom to be installed on the 3rd floor of a 90 year old house. We're trying to figure out our options for where the toilet can go and still connect to a new waste line that we'd like to have run down the inside of a closet on the 2nd floor.

Our joist space is 10" from the underside of the existing floor to the top of the ceiling below. The floor itself is 7/8" thick. We know that we need to allow 1/4" fall per 1' of distance but don't know how many inches get used up by the connection between the flange and the closet bend. Can anyone give us an idea of how much space we'll have left between the bottom of the closet bend and the topside of the ceiling below?

Also, the house has two other toilets but they're on a separate waste line. Is there any reason that we should put this new toilet on a 4" waste line rather than a 3"?
